dc.description.abstractIt is highly inappropriate to perform the reliability analysis for discrete information using earlier developed methods because most of these methods assumed that the distribution of variables is continuous. On the other hand reliability analysis using Akaike information criterion (AIC) is an appropriate method to calculate reliability for discrete information, since it uses discrete information directly which stands as an advantage in reliability analysis. As we know reliability becomes more accurate with increase in number of discrete information. Therefore in this paper, we suggest a suitable number of samples to calculate reliability. To evaluate accuracy of reliability, we compare AIC with Monte Carlo simulation (MCS) using mathematical examples.en_US
